We Have Band - Ternion (Album)
We Have Band's sophomore release Ternion (out on Naïve; January 31st digital release, February physical release) takes its name from a noun for ‘three; triad’. Eager to move past their widely embraced chopped-and-split sound/nonsensical lyrics on the first album, WHB have gone forth in a decidedly more personal, dynamic direction: ‘After All’ has them tackling heady moral quandaries (We took this hook/to soothe the fevers/by hook by crook/become believers), lost love (And now we’re both turned upside down/empty hearts turned inside out/Pick a story its yours to tell/And on your knees you tell it very well), reluctant responsibility (Marching through the streets/we heard them drum for 40 days and 40 nights/it’s all they hummed/their colors jumped up in the flames/jump in the fire/empty words and clever games of which we tire/needing someone to blame for this position/needing someone to blame/but who will listen), and far more.
And, no doubt, the virtuoso sonic moments are still here, more matured and vibrant: Doo-Wop Organs in ‘Visionary’, what sounds like an old AOL dial-up in the opening of ‘Watertight’, a taut strumming breakdown in the end of ‘Pressure On’. At times this record recalls the best of Silver Apples, a band equally as exhilarating and hard to classify. Ternion is an album that resists a ‘scene’. It sounds as if it could have been recorded out-of-time, both in its minute improvisations and its resistance to ephemeral music trends. We Have Band took to heart a fundamental paradox: By digging deep into ones own neuroses and inner lives, a timeless thing can emerge that relates to all.
We Have Band is not simply content to let Ternion stand on its own, though it is proven to be exceedingly capable: They will also be releasing a deluxe edition featuring a deconstruction of the record titled, Ternion Aside. It is a remixing of their own record, an ever-evolving, organic process.
At the end of Ternion, We Have Band asks “Where Are Your People?”. In the case of those who should hear Ternion: They are here, there, and everywhere. A perfect triangle.

Lana Del Rey - Born To Die (Clams Casino Remix)
This meeting was inevitable, and here it is: Clams Casino and Lana Del Ray. These two have been making far too many publicity waves in the indie circuit not to cross paths, and Clams’ remix of Del Rey’s ‘Born to Die’ is the remarkably strange result. Sonically, this pairing makes little sense: Clams Casino has made his name producing for some of hip-hop’s youngest, most explosive and charismatic acts, like Lil’ B and A$AP Rocky. Lana Del Rey has made her name on a throwback, California 50’s aesthetic. What would a pairing of these two soundlike? It sounds like Clams’ aesthetic has prevailed over Rey. Clams Casino, to produce, often used to type something like ‘blue’ into Limewire, and sample the first thing that came up. Mood over everything, and ‘Born to Die’ is a loaded phrase that Clams has treated with a jarring production most similar to A$AP Rocky’s “Bass”. It is a jolt of energy to Rey’s mature voice.

Simian Ghost - Wolf Girl (Video)
The video for Simian Ghost’s ‘Wolf Girl’ tells a story of primal courtship far closer to the strangeness of Cocteau’s “Beauty and the Beast” than Disney’s. The set is an archaic, golden hued hotel where one can fight their lover with 19th century pillows and warm candlelight is their only guide. But, the video maintains a crucial, cold distance: The Wolf Girl and her lover eventually take a walk outside and gaze at the moon. He is gazing, she is glaring. He is near erased from the frame while she glares at an alternate life not gone but merely momentarily interrupted. There is a ghostly presence achieved in both song and video; a presence that suggest that real vs. mythic is not an opposition but an adjoined experience.
David Bowie - Let's Dance (SIMØNE RMX)
SIMØNE transforms David Bowie’s ‘Lets Dance’ from cabaret classic to dance-hall disco. Bowie’s original theatrics are pared down and SIMØNE instead opting for darker synths / compact vocals. It is a major change from the original, and, considering the history of ‘Let’s Dance’, change is a neutral value. After the success of ‘Lets Dance’, Bowie stated that he felt he had alienated his old audience, and he didn’t recognize his new one: "I remember looking out over these waves of people [who were coming to hear this record played live] and thinking, 'I wonder how many Velvet Underground albums these people have in their record collections?' It is likely that most listeners of SIMØNE’s ‘Let’s Dance’ remix are amiably familiar with the original, and will greet this bold addition with open ears and minds.

Jay Lamar & Jesse Oliver - Diamonda
These are the first original tracks from the team of Jay Lamar and Jesse Oliver, a production/DJ duo coming from Helsinki (and hailed by the likes of Treasure Fingers, Philosophy of Sound, and ATTAR!, to name but a few). Oliver and Lamar met at music production school, and soon took up a kinship based on their mutual love for ‘all things House, Disco, and Electro’. The duo offers up original mixes of ‘Diamonda’ and ‘Opal’ , along with three remixes of ‘Diamonda’(remixed by Xinobi, Justin Faust, and Bright Shades, respectively). This is DiscoTexas’ first release of 2012, and they’ve started out right.
